Early Life and Family Background

Min Woo Lee was born on July 27, 1998, in Perth, Western Australia, to parents Soonam Lee and Clara Lee. Growing up in a family with a strong golfing pedigree, Min Woo was introduced to the sport at a young age by his older sister, Minjee Lee, who would later go on to become a successful professional golfer on the LPGA Tour. With the support and encouragement of his family, Min Woo quickly developed a passion for the game and began to showcase his natural talent on the golf course.

Junior Golf Achievements and Amateur Success

Throughout his junior golf career, Min Woo Lee established himself as one of the most promising young players in Australia. He won numerous state and national titles, including the Australian Boys' Amateur in 2015 and the Western Australian Amateur in 2016. Lee's success on the junior circuit earned him recognition as one of the top amateur golfers in the world, with impressive performances in international events such as the U.S. Junior Amateur and the British Amateur.

Transition to Professional Golf

In 2018, at the age of 19, Min Woo Lee made the decision to turn professional, forgoing his remaining amateur eligibility to pursue his dream of competing on the world stage. He began his professional journey on the European Tour, earning a spot through Qualifying School and embarking on a new chapter in his golfing career. Despite the challenges of adapting to life as a touring professional, Lee remained focused on his goals and dedicated to improving his game.

Breakthrough Victory at the ISPS Handa Vic Open

Min Woo Lee's breakout moment came in 2020 when he secured his maiden European Tour victory at the ISPS Handa Vic Open. In a thrilling final round, Lee displayed remarkable poise and skill, holding off a strong field to claim the title by two strokes. This win not only validated Lee's decision to turn professional but also solidified his status as a rising star in the world of golf, capable of competing and succeeding at the highest level.
